This 1955 Beechcraft T34A Mentor (N4002F) presents an excellent opportunity for warbird enthusiasts seeking an accessible entry into vintage military aircraft ownership. The airframe shows 7,164 total hours with a Continental O-470-13 engine showing 86 hours since overhaul and a propeller with 66 hours since IRAN. The aircraft underwent a significant panel modernization featuring twin Garmin GI-275 displays, a GTN 650Xi GPS/COM, and a Garmin transponder with ADS-B In/Out capability, complemented by a uAvionix Tail Beacon and Airframe Life Extension Cable System (ALEC).
Maintained under a standard airworthiness certificate, this Mentor boasts an interesting service history with the USAF (1955-1961) and Indonesian Air Force (1961-1979) before returning to the U.S. in 1990 for a complete rebuild. The aircraft received its current paint in 1993 and comes equipped with Hooker harnesses. Recent maintenance includes an annual inspection and pitot-static system checks valid through April 2025. Currently configured for VFR operation with two seats, this aerobatic-capable warbird is hangared in Marco Island, Florida.
